One of the key advantages is the prevention of deer damage to gardens, crops, and landscapes. By installing a deer fence, property owners can protect their plants and trees from being eaten or trampled by deer, ensuring the preservation of their investment. Additionally, deer fence installation helps to reduce the risk of deer-related accidents on roads, as it creates a physical barrier that prevents deer from entering highways or residential areas. Furthermore, deer fences can also help prevent the spread of tick-borne diseases, as deer are known carriers of ticks. Overall, deer fence installation is an effective and practical solution for safeguarding property and promoting a harmonious coexistence between humans and wildlife.
When it comes to protecting your garden or property from deer, installing a sturdy and reliable barrier is essential. Deer fence installation is a process that involves setting up a physical barrier to prevent deer from entering an area. This type of fencing is designed to be tall and durable, ensuring that deer cannot jump over or break through it. By installing a deer fence, you can safeguard your plants, trees, and crops from potential damage caused by deer grazing. Proper installation of a deer fence requires careful planning, precise measurements, and the use of high-quality materials to ensure its effectiveness and longevity.
